This paper deals with a spatial scheduling problem for the painting process in shipbuilding. This problem is complicated because both scheduling and spatial allocation of the blocks in the paint shop, and the workload balance among working teams should be considered simultaneously. The spatial scheduling system for the block painting process includes an operation strategy algorithm, a block scheduling algorithm, a block arrangement algorithm, and a block assignment algorithm. This system generates the block painting schedules that satisfy due date, working space constraint, and workload balance among working teams. This system has been tested using actual scheduling data from a shipyard and successfully implemented in a paint shop in a shipbuilding company.
